Theater building
Photo: Ebyabe, CC BY 2.5.
The Hippodrome Theatre is a regional professional theatre in downtown , , . It was founded in 1973 by local actors and was added to the National Register of Historic Places on July 10, 1979. is situated 690 feet north of Gainesville Fire and Rescue Station 1.
